On a side note. I came very very close to dropping it within 10 minutes of owning. I had the fork turned and hit the front brake as I was pulling into a parking spot. The nose dove and it started to go over. Took all my strength to keep it from going down. Those dual disk brembos have about 150000% more stopping power than that single disk system on my Slim. Combine that with a way higher center of gravity and it was almost a disaster. Still trying to get over my fear of scraping the floor boards on every corner. I'm starting to realize I can actually lean this bike over a little bit in the twisties... it's fun. I do miss the narrow seat on the slim and the rock solid idle. I'll be shopping for a seat and something to give the exhaust more growl.
